The decomposition of global conformal invariants IV: A proposition on local Riemannian invariants
read the original abstract
This is the fourth in a series of papers where we prove a conjecture of Deser and Schwimmer regarding the algebraic structure of ``global conformal invariants''; these are defined to be conformally invariant integrals of geometric scalars. The conjecture asserts that the integrand of any such integral can be expressed as a linear combination of a local conformal invariant, a divergence and of the Chern-Gauss-Bonnet integrand. The present paper lays out the second half of this entire work: The second half proves certain purely algebraic statements regarding local Riemannian invariants; these were used extensively in [3,4]. These results may be of independent interest, applicable to related problems.
